Current State vs Future State Comparison

Current State

(Traditional)

Sustainable sourcing verification is performed manually during new supplier qualification or periodic reviews. Procurement teams request sustainability certifications (organic, fair trade, Rainforest Alliance, MSC, FSC) via email and manually file PDF certificates. Verification of certification validity involves manually checking certification body websites. Supplier sustainability assessments use email questionnaires with subjective scoring. Ethical sourcing audits for labor practices are conducted periodically with paper checklists. Sustainable sourcing goals (e.g., 50% certified sustainable seafood) are tracked manually in spreadsheets with annual reviews. No systematic monitoring of certification expirations or supplier sustainability performance over time.

Pain Points

  • Data Fragmentation: Siloed data across systems complicates aggregation and reporting.
  • Lack of Standardization: Different formats from suppliers hinder comparison and benchmarking.
  • Manual Processes: Reliance on Excel and email leads to errors and inefficiencies.
  • Limited Supplier Engagement: Suppliers may lack resources to complete audits accurately.
  • Verification Costs: Third-party audits can be expensive, especially for SMEs.
  • Time Delays: The verification process can take weeks or months, delaying product launches.
  • Consumer Trust Issues: Lack of transparent evidence may lead to perceptions of greenwashing.

Future State

(Agentic)

An orchestrator agent coordinates comprehensive sustainable sourcing management. Certification agents automatically collect and verify supplier certifications (organic, fair trade, MSC, FSC, Rainforest Alliance) through digital portals with certification body API validation. Scoring agents assess supplier sustainability performance using standardized frameworks (EcoVadis, Sedex) with automated data collection and consistent evaluation. Monitoring agents track certification expiration dates with 90-day advance alerts and renewal workflows. Goal tracking agents measure progress toward sustainable sourcing commitments (percentage certified, volume, spend) in real-time dashboards. Verification agents perform periodic audits of ethical sourcing practices with digital checklists and finding management. Analytics agents identify opportunities to expand sustainable sourcing and quantify environmental impact.
